Output 73eda1c586f876802d2ef4ac9823926dd7b19e6f1295bf0734a7a6cd70ec27a1:1

value
1141745510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308bb0e3b7d5fc173dd1383abc1668c5d3e91583 OP_EQUAL
address
367hhehBVxwWgJMQpRLXp8DZEjBLr2x5HE
transaction
73eda1c586f876802d2ef4ac9823926dd7b19e6f1295bf0734a7a6cd70ec27a1
spent
true